Chinese hackers are suspected of carrying out a
"massive breach" affecting the data of millions of
US government workers, officials said.
The Office of Personnel Management (OPM)
confirmed on Thursday that almost four million
current and past employees have been affected.
The breach could potentially affect every federal
agency, officials said.
Susan Collins, a member of the Senate Intelligence
Committee, said it was thought to have originated
in China.
The Chinese embassy in Washington warned
against "jumping to conclusions".
Embassy spokesman Zhu Haiquan told Reuters
news agency that the accusations were "not
responsible, and counterproductive".
Analysis by Tom Bateman, BBC News, Washington
It is the scale of what the OPM calls a "cyber
intrusion" in April this year that is breathtaking -
the records of four million former and current
government employees may have been breached.
The agency is contacting all of those potentially
affected, offering to insure them against identity
fraud. Of even greater concern may be the fact that
security clearance information on government
officials could have been targeted.
US officials are only too aware of the real damage
caused by such virtual threats. In the past year, a
growing number of government agencies and
companies - most notoriously Sony Pictures -
have fallen victim to such attacks.
OPM serves as the human resource department for
the federal government. The agency issues security
clearances and compiles records of all federal
government employees.
Information stored on OPM databases includes
employee job assignments, performance reviews
and training, according to officials.
The breach did not involve background checks and
clearance investigations, officials said.
Mrs Collins called the breach "yet another
indication of a foreign power probing successfully
and focusing on what appears to be data that
would identify people with security clearances".

Using a new cyber security system known as
Einstein, the OPM detected a "cyber-intrusion" in
April 2015. The FBI said it was investigating the
breach.
Ken Ammon, chief strategy officer of Xceedium - a
cyber security firm - warned that the hacked data
could be used to impersonate or blackmail federal
employees with access to sensitive information.
Previous hack attacks on US government
In November 2014 a hack compromised files
belonging to 25,000 employees of the
Department of Homeland Security, as well as
thousands of other federal workers
In March 2014 hackers breached OPM networks,
targeting government staff with security
clearance, but the attempt was blocked before
any data was stolen. The intrusion was traced
to China
In 2006, hackers believed to be based in China
breached the system of a sensitive bureau in
the US Department of Commerce. Hundreds of
workstations had to be replaced
Congressman Adam Schiff has called for cyber
databases to be upgraded in light of the most
recent attack.
Americans "expect that federal computer networks
are maintained with state of the art defences", Mr
Schiff said.
"The cyber threat from hackers, criminals, terrorists
and state actors is one of the greatest challenges
we face on a daily basis, and it's clear that a
substantial improvement in our cyber databases
and defences is perilously overdue."
